-/*
- script-interface.cc -- implement Script_interface
-
+/*
+ script-interface.cc -- implement Script_interface
+
source file of the GNU LilyPond music typesetter
-
- (c) 1999--2004 Han-Wen Nienhuys <hanwen@cs.uu.nl>
-
- */
+
+ (c) 1999--2005 Han-Wen Nienhuys <hanwen@cs.uu.nl>
+*/
#include "directional-element-interface.hh"
#include "warn.hh"
if (!d)
{
/* FIXME: This should never happen: `arbitrary' directions. */
- programming_error ("Script direction not yet known!");
+ programming_error ("script direction not yet known");
d = DOWN;
}
Direction dir = Side_position_interface::get_direction (me);
if (!dir)
{
- programming_error ("Script direction not known, but stencil wanted.");
+ programming_error ("script direction unknown, but stencil wanted");
dir = DOWN;
}
return get_stencil (me, dir).smobbed_copy ();
struct Text_script
{
- static bool has_interface (Grob*);
+ static bool has_interface (Grob *);
};
-ADD_INTERFACE (Text_script,"text-script-interface",
- "An object that is put above or below a note",
- "add-stem-support slur script-priority inside-slur");
-
+ADD_INTERFACE (Text_script, "text-script-interface",
+ "An object that is put above or below a note",
+ "add-stem-support slur script-priority inside-slur");
/*
Hmm. Where should we put add-stem-support ?
- */
+*/
ADD_INTERFACE (Script_interface, "script-interface",
- "An object that is put above or below a note",
- "add-stem-support slur-padding slur script-priority script-stencil inside-slur");
+ "An object that is put above or below a note",
+ "add-stem-support slur-padding slur script-priority script-stencil inside-slur");